Plus Size Bras: Supportive and Flattering for Every Occasion
Choosing the right bra is crucial for comfort and style. A well-fitting bra not only supports your bust but also enhances your silhouette. For full-figured women, finding the perfect bra is even more important to prevent issues like back pain.
The Importance of Proper Support
Women with larger busts often experience back problems if their bras don't provide adequate support. Plus size bras are designed to address this issue, offering the necessary reinforcement to reduce discomfort.
Everyday Comfort
For daily wear, plus size bras are both practical and comfortable. They are ideal for well-endowed women, ensuring they feel supported and at ease throughout the day.
Achieve the Perfect Shape with Plus Size Minimizers
Plus size minimizer bras are designed to shape your bust beautifully while reducing projection by at least an inch. The innovative design includes straps positioned closer at the back, alleviating pressure on the shoulders and minimizing back pain.
Variety in Plus Size Bras
The plus size category offers a wide range of options, including underwire bras, soft cup bras, and seamless bras. These styles often feature satin or lace details for added elegance and sensuality. Comfort is maximized with soft foam support rings under the cups and wider, padded straps that are barely noticeable.
Experience All-Day Comfort
The most important aspect of a well-chosen bra is its fit and comfort. With plus size bras, you can enjoy all-day wear without irritation, ensuring you feel confident and comfortable no matter the occasion.
